[Interest] Squish for open source

2021-04-19 Thread Vadim Peretokin
Following the news that Qt has acquired the excellent UI-based testing
software Squish (https://www.qt.io/blog/quality-assurance-tools), could
that offering be extended to open source projects by QtC?

There's no real alternatives that I know of that can do UI-based testing
for Qt Widgets projects - or if I haven't looked hard enough, happy to hear
suggestions.
